Here are some WB tools I think are must-have:
Directory Tool - ABCDir
Palette Locking - LoadCMAP
Screen Promotion - ModePro
Menu Enhancer - MagicMenu, AddTools
Icon Editor - Iconian (2.9r)
Window utils - WindowToFront, Iconify & TitleShadow
Title Clock - NISclock
Text Copying - PowerSnap
Drive Click Stop - DrivePrefs
Full screen shell - ScreenShell
File finder - SimpleFind3
Disk Salvage - DiskSalv 4
Application Monitor - SnoopDOS
System Monitor - Scout (37.249)
Binary Editor - Hex
Virus Program - VirusZ
Magnifyer - Zoom
They should all be on Aminet.
